History and Traditional Use
Astragalus has been used in traditional Chinese medicine for thousands of years. Historically, it was prized for its ability to strengthen the body's resistance to disease, support vitality, and promote longevity.
What is Astragalus?
Astragalus, scientifically known as Astragalus membranaceus, is a perennial herb native to Asia. It is known for its immune-boosting properties and is commonly used in herbal formulas to enhance overall health.
Active Compounds in Astragalus
Astragalus contains several bioactive compounds, including polysaccharides, saponins, and flavonoids. These compounds contribute to its an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, and immunomodulatory effects, which are key to its role as an immune booster.

Safety Considerations & Side Effects
Astragalus is generally well-tolerated when taken at recommended doses. However, some individuals may experience mild side effects such as gastrointestinal discomfort. It is crucial to consult with a healthcare provider, especially if you are pregnant, nursing, or taking other medications.
